What Is Vehicle Signage?

Vehicle signage refers to the use of graphics, decals, wraps, or lettering applied to cars, vans, trucks, and other commercial vehicles to promote a business. These designs typically include logos, brand colors, contact details, and key messages that make the brand instantly recognizable.

Businesses often use signage for vehicles to ensure their brand is visible while driving, parked, or even stuck in traffic. This constant exposure makes it one of the most efficient forms of outdoor advertising available today.

Why Businesses Are Choosing Vehicle Signage

One of the biggest advantages of vehicle signage is its reach. A single branded vehicle can be seen by thousands of people in a single day, especially in busy urban areas. Unlike online ads that can be skipped or ignored, vehicle signage is naturally integrated into everyday surroundings.

Another major benefit is credibility. A professionally branded vehicle makes a business appear more established and trustworthy. Customers are more likely to feel confident hiring a service provider who arrives in a clearly marked vehicle rather than an unbranded one.

Cost efficiency is also a key factor. Compared to recurring advertising expenses such as digital ads or billboards, vehicle signage delivers continuous exposure for years with minimal maintenance.

Types of Vehicle Signage Options

Businesses can choose from several signage styles depending on their goals and budget:

  • Vinyl lettering – Ideal for simple branding like logos and contact details
  • Partial wraps – Cover specific sections of the vehicle for a bold look
  • Full vehicle wraps – Transform the entire vehicle into a high-impact visual advertisement
  • Magnetic signs – A flexible option for temporary branding

Each option allows businesses to tailor their messaging while maintaining brand consistency across their fleet.

Best Practices for Effective Vehicle Signage

To maximize impact, vehicle signage should be designed with clarity and simplicity in mind. Overcrowded designs can be difficult to read, especially when vehicles are in motion. Clear fonts, strong contrast, and concise messaging ensure the signage remains effective at a glance.

Brand consistency is equally important. Colors, logos, and messaging should align with other marketing materials so customers can easily recognize the brand across different platforms.

Placement also matters. Key information such as the business name and services should be positioned where they are most visible, including doors, rear panels, and side sections.

Industries That Benefit the Most

Vehicle signage is particularly effective for service-based industries such as plumbing, electrical work, landscaping, cleaning services, and delivery companies. These businesses already operate on the road, making signage a natural extension of their daily operations.

However, it’s not limited to trades alone. Real estate agencies, event companies, food services, and even corporate fleets are increasingly using vehicle signage to strengthen brand presence and reach new audiences.
